8 namespace remoting { | |
9 | |
10 struct NetworkSettings { | |
11 | |
12 // When hosts are configured with NAT traversal disabled they will | |
13 // typically also limit their P2P ports to this range, so that | |
14 // sessions may be blocked or un-blocked via firewall rules. | |
15 static const int kDefaultMinPort = 12400; | |
16 static const int kDefaultMaxPort = 12409; | |
17 | |
18 enum NatTraversalMode { | |
19 // Active NAT traversal using STUN and relay servers. | |
20 NAT_TRAVERSAL_ENABLED, | |
21 | |
22 // Don't use STUN or relay servers. Accept incoming P2P connection | |
23 // attempts, but don't initiate any. This ensures that the peer is | |
24 // on the same network. Note that connection will always fail if | |
25 // both ends use this mode. | |
26 NAT_TRAVERSAL_DISABLED, | |
27 | |
28 // Don't use STUN or relay servers but make outgoing connections. | |
29 NAT_TRAVERSAL_OUTGOING, | |
30 }; | |
31 | |
32 NetworkSettings() | |
33 : nat_traversal_mode(NAT_TRAVERSAL_DISABLED), | |
34 min_port(0), | |
35 max_port(0) { | |
36 } | |
37 | |
38 explicit NetworkSettings(NatTraversalMode nat_traversal_mode) | |
39 : nat_traversal_mode(nat_traversal_mode), | |
40 min_port(0), | |
41 max_port(0) { | |
42 } | |
43 | |
44 NatTraversalMode nat_traversal_mode; | |
45 | |
46 // |min_port| and |max_port| specify range (inclusive) of ports used by | |
47 // P2P sessions. Any port can be used when both values are set to 0. | |
48 int min_port; | |
49 int max_port; | |
50 }; | |
51 | |
52 } // namespace remoting | |
